Yes its more acceptable than in the past but it depends on the generation you speak of. Older people in general still look down on it while young people mostly accept it as no big deal or even cool. Also certain parts of the country are very conservative. In the cities no one cares while in rural areas its not accepted as much. As far as retail stores, employees are usually paid commission and national chains have policies accepting anyone no matter how they’re dressed because the dollar wins over all else. Crossdressing is still at the bottom of the status ladder while trans is cool and trendy.
